[0031] The invention provides a blind spectrum sensing method based on frequency domain box dimension. The steps of the method are as follows: first, the signal received by the cognitive radio sensing node is sampled to obtain a discrete time series signal, and a fixed length is intercepted from it, and then the intercepted time series is subjected to DFT transformation to convert it from the time domain to the frequency domain, and then the calculation Its box dimension, and finally compare the frequency domain box dimension value with the set decision threshold to distinguish the signal from the noise, judge the existence of the main user, and achieve the unknown prior knowledge of the main user signal and the uncertainty of the noise.
